Rechercher : dans
Par :

Masquer le déroulement d'une macro sous excel

Dernière réponse le 25 avr 2005 à 06:00:07 emmanuel, le 24 avr 2005 à 17:14:36 
 Signaler ce message aux modérateurs

Bonjour,
Je travaille sur un PC portable possédant windows XP. J'ai créer un projet sur excel avec quelques macro faites à partir du menu.
Le déroulement d'une macro passant d'une page à l'autre est assez désagréable à regarder sur l'écran. Comment masquer ce déroulement?
Merci pour vos réponses
Emmanuel

Meilleures réponses pour « masquer le déroulement d'une macro sous excel » dans :
Exécuter une macro VoirExécuter une macro Excel et Calc proposent plusieurs façons d’exécuter une macro : en la sélectionnant dans une liste, dans la boîte de dialogue Macro ; par un raccourci clavier ; en l’attachant à un bouton de la barre d’outils ; ...

1

Armojax, le 24 avr 2005 à 18:27:43

Bonjour Emmanuel,

Sans précision particulière, ta macro, en s'exécutant, montre tout ce qu'elle fait : sélections, activation de feuilles, etc...
Pour éviter ce feu d'artifices, il faut, en début de macro, désactiver la mise à jour de l'écran, avec la commande :

Application.ScreenUpdating = False
et la réactiver en fin de macro :
Application.ScreenUpdating = True

Ainsi, la macro tourne beaucoup plus vite. Pendant l'exécution, le sablier apparaît si ça dure assez longtemps.

Ajx.

Répondre à Armojax

2

 emmanuel, le 25 avr 2005 à 06:00:07

Merci beaucoup pour toutes ces précisions. Salutations
Emmanuel

Répondre à emmanuel